    Brief update on PTR & the upcoming ATLAS 1.5 patch

    Hey Pathfinders!

    Just wanted to come in and give you a quick status update for ATLAS 1.5 before the weekend. We are planning on launching the Public Test Realm next Wednesday, the 3rd of April, and by then there will be an in-depth Captain’s Log which will do a deep dive on the entire patch so you know what to expect.

    Full patch notes can be found here:

    Going forward, we expect subsequent major updates to come on a monthly basis, which will include more content such as new items, weapons, creatures and new areas for players to check out!

    large.Creature2.jpg

    We know that this update has taken quite some time and we really appreciate everyone’s patience as we dug down to the core of the claiming system and reworked it. We expect that we’ll have this ready to ship onto the main network by the week of the 8th of April.

    Following ATLAS 1.5, there will be a lot more to come in terms of design changes and content. This announcement post contains a sneak peek of some upcoming new creatures, can you guess what abilities they’ll have?

    Not to poke holes in your theory, but do you know anything about the middle East during the Renaissance, particularly around the Indian Ocean?  There was piracy in so-called "Biblical Times".

    Do you consider a pirate to be a criminal? There were French ships that captured Spanish or Portuguese ships all the time during that period. But they would sail back to France and weren't condemned in any way. In fact if you want to go back that far I would wager that all ships captured and robbed during this time(Renaissance) were done so militarily. It was extremely expensive or close to impossible to get the resources you needed to build a ship-it had to be funded by the crown. So the idea of low criminals getting their hands on a ship that could actually attack other ships seems unlikely. When I think of a pirate I think of someone breaking the law and acting in self interest, and not representing any sovereign state. Piracy in that regard did not become a threat to trade until the 17th century(where independent ports operated separate from the guise of a monarchy.) But if your definition of a pirate is anyone who robs a boat(regardless of state affiliation) then yeah, sure, pirates have been around for thousands of years. My bad 🙂
